William James, the chair of Harvard's psychology department, delivered a series of lectures called Talks to Teachers. He says that in giving these lectures he learned to take out more abstruse academic detail and leave in the practical implications and the most basic principles.
He says, what I have learned from giving these lectures to school teachers is that I would learn to take out more and more of this, like, abstruse academic detail and leave in the practical implications and the most basic principles.
And you can actually just download Talks to Teachers for free.
